网络性能监控如何支持网络故障预测?

在数字化时代,网络已经成为企业运营的命脉。网络性能的稳定直接影响到企业的生产效率、客户体验以及业务连续性。因此,网络性能监控对于企业来说至关重要。本文将探讨网络性能监控如何支持网络故障预测,帮助企业提前预防网络问题,降低故障带来的损失。

一、网络性能监控的重要性

网络性能监控是指对网络设备、链路、应用等各个层面的性能进行实时监测和分析。通过监控,企业可以及时发现网络中的异常情况,对潜在问题进行预警,从而确保网络稳定运行。

1. 提高网络运维效率

网络性能监控可以帮助企业实时了解网络状态,及时发现并解决网络问题,降低故障发生概率。在故障发生时,运维人员可以迅速定位问题所在,缩短故障处理时间,提高运维效率。

2. 优化网络资源配置

通过网络性能监控,企业可以了解网络设备、链路、应用的性能指标,为网络优化提供数据支持。例如,通过分析网络流量,企业可以合理分配带宽资源,提高网络利用率。

3. 降低故障损失

网络故障可能导致企业业务中断、数据丢失等严重后果。通过网络性能监控,企业可以提前发现潜在问题,采取措施预防故障发生,降低故障损失。

二、网络故障预测

网络故障预测是指通过对网络性能数据的分析,预测网络故障发生的可能性。网络故障预测可以帮助企业提前发现并解决潜在问题,降低故障风险。

1. 数据采集与处理

网络故障预测需要大量网络性能数据作为基础。企业可以通过以下方式采集数据:

  • 网络设备采集:通过SNMP、Syslog等协议,从网络设备中采集性能数据。
  • 链路采集:通过BGP、LACP等协议,从链路中采集性能数据。
  • 应用采集:通过APM、APM等工具,从应用层面采集性能数据。

采集到的数据需要进行清洗、转换等处理,以便后续分析。

2. 数据分析

网络故障预测主要采用以下分析方法:

  • 统计分析:对网络性能数据进行统计分析,找出异常值和趋势。
  • 机器学习:利用机器学习算法,对网络性能数据进行建模,预测故障发生的可能性。
  • 专家系统:结合专家经验,对网络性能数据进行综合分析,预测故障发生的可能性。

三、案例分析

以下是一个网络故障预测的案例分析:

某企业网络出现频繁的丢包现象,影响了业务正常运行。通过网络性能监控,发现丢包主要发生在核心交换机上。进一步分析发现,丢包原因可能与交换机CPU负载过高有关。

针对此问题,企业采取了以下措施:

  • 优化网络配置:调整交换机端口带宽,降低CPU负载。
  • 升级交换机:更换高性能交换机,提高网络性能。
  • 加强监控:持续关注网络性能,及时发现并解决潜在问题。

通过以上措施,企业成功解决了网络丢包问题,保障了业务正常运行。

四、总结

网络性能监控对于网络故障预测具有重要意义。通过实时监测网络状态,分析性能数据,企业可以提前发现并解决潜在问题,降低故障风险。同时,网络故障预测可以帮助企业优化网络资源配置,提高网络运维效率。因此,企业应重视网络性能监控和网络故障预测,确保网络稳定运行。

猜你喜欢:全景性能监控